I was so fortunate to conceive a child, after battling with PCOS for 10 years now! I followed strict doctors orders, and things went well the first 2 trimesters, but then I developed a very bad case of pre-eclampsia...had to be on hospital bedrest for weeks, and still had to have an emergency c-section 6 weeks early. My husband and I are now ready to try for baby number 2, and I wondered if pre-eclampsia could be linked to my pcos. I was lucky enough to bi-pass gest diab the first go-round, and I know some women just get pre-eclampsia with their 1st child, but I can't help but wonder if it's linked to my pcos, and what the chances of this happening again might be??? It was very scary, so we are trying to weigh our decisions here.
